Moving Checklist
6 - 8 Weeks Prior To Moving:

This is a great time to start outlining the information of your move.

Make a list of products you intend on relocating to your new house and items you wish to require to storage. Make a list of items to be managed by the mover and those you will handle yourself. Dispose of the products that you do not think about a garage and need sale if you have time.
Get quotes from several moving companies.
Research study and pick an expert moving company. After choosing your mover, go over expenses, packing, timing, and other required information.
Many moving expenditures are tax deductible, so maintain a file with essential details and receipts for moving-related costs.
If moving to a new neighborhood, find out about the schools, parks, entertainment, and neighborhood programs from the local Chamber of Commerce or Visitor's Bureau.
Transfer medical, residential or commercial property, auto, and fire insurance through your insurance coverage agent.
Place all your medical records in a safe location. Do not forget prescriptions, vaccination records, and other important info.

4 - 5 Weeks Prior To Moving:

If you are planning to do some part of the packaging, begin collecting moving and loading products. These can be bought from your self storage or moving company.
Contact your regional Post Workplace and fill out a USPS Modification of Address kind. Also, offer your brand-new address to your telephone company, trash business, cable/satellite, water, electric company, Web provider, insurer, banks and monetary institutions, clubs, local federal government agencies, and any other utility business.
Register your kids in their brand-new schools. It would be a good idea to include your kids in the moving procedure; they can help pack their toys and products from their space.
Contact your current utility business - electrical energy, gas, phone, and others for disconnection after your scheduled leave. read more Don't forget to call ahead to have actually energies connected to your new house!
If you have family pets, make arrangements for transportation. If there are specific requirements for pet ownership in your new area, discover out. Also obtain the veterinarian records.

2 - 4 Weeks Before Moving:

You might want to organize for a sitter on moving day to ensure they remain safe during the packing procedure if you have young kids.
Remember to return library books and anything you have obtained. Likewise gather items you have loaned out.
You may NOT wish to load your valuables in the moving van; consider taking them with you.
Plants - some state laws do not enable moving home plants. Plants might be offered to friends, or perhaps a local charity.
If you are going to take a trip by automobile, you may wish to get the automobile serviced prior to your departure.
Start loading products you don't currently require. Determine which items go to storage and which items go to your brand-new house if leasing a storage unit.
Don't forget anything in basement, attic, and closets. Don't ignore cleaning out safety deposit boxes.
Disassemble your computer and backup essential computer system files. Prevent exposure to extreme temperature levels.
Properly get rid of flammable items like fireworks, cleaning fluids, matches, acids, chemistry sets, and other dangerous products.

1 Week Prior To Moving:

Make sure your items are labeled: 'delicate', 'load very first', 'load last', and 'do not pack'. This is necessary to make sure the security of your items.
Guarantee that your moving business understands the right address and contact number of your brand-new house. Likewise supply them with an address and mobile phone number to get in touch with you till you get to your new home if possible.
It is important to empty, defrost, and clean your fridge at least a day prior to moving.
Make plans flexible, and make arrangements in case of delays. Validate travel plans and keep products you will require while the rest of your valuables remain in transit.
Load a box individually with the important things you will require immediately upon getting to your new house. : Snacks, disposable plates and cups, bathroom items, and garbage bags.

Vacating Day

Completely examine your closets, drawers, shelves, attic, and garage to make sure nothing is left.
Turn off all light switches and lock all doors and windows.
Be around throughout the loading process. get more info Inspect the facilities and ensure that absolutely nothing is left.
There should be somebody to direct the movers. The chauffeur should have in composing your name and contact number. Remember to take your destination representative's name, address, and contact number.
Be patient if you reach your brand-new house prior to your mover.
Sign the expense of lading and ensure your new address and phone number are appropriate.

Move-in Day And After:

While dumping, make sure there is no damage and no products are missing out on. Plan out placement of major items in your home. If moving to a brand-new state, you will require to restore your motorist's license and modify any wills and other legal papers.
